A DAY IN THE LIFE OF Reimbursement, RCM Quality Auditor

The RCM Quality Auditor conducts monthly quality assurance audits of the work performed by members of the revenue cycle management team. In addition to conducting these audits, this individual is responsible for developing and maintaining comprehensive quality assurance documentation. This includes auditing reports, performance metrics, and process improvement plans to effectively communicate results to reimbursement management.

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E

  • Minimum Requirements
    • Bachelor's degree in accounting, healthcare administration, or related field required and/or equivalent combination of experience and education. 
    • Minimum of eight years of experience in a revenue cycle management role.
    • Minimum of two years of experience performing Quality audits in a revenue cycle management environment.  
    • Proven track record of consistently applying policies and procedures in a healthcare billing environment.
    • Extensive knowledge of all tasks within the health insurance billing process
    • Hands-on experience creating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s)
    • Knowledge of healthcare compliance regulations, such as HIPAA, Medicare, Medicaid, and commercial payer guidelines.
